Hong Kong: Stocks open 0.53% lower
Published Tue, Jul 14, 2015 · 01:55 AM
[HONG KONG] Hong Kong equities slipped 0.53 per cent in the first few minutes of trade on Tuesday after a more than seven per cent rally in the previous three sessions, while traders remain on edge about volatility in mainland markets.
The Hang Seng Index eased 132.99 points to 25,091.02.
